Home » Hanafi Fiqh » Askimam.org » Is it true that if you are holding the Qur’aan in you hands and it falls down, you have also to throw yourself down to show that you are guilty and also respect the Qur’aan?
No, one should not throw oneself down. Instead, pick up the Qur’aan and kiss it.
And Allah Ta’ala Knows Best.
Mufti Ebrahim Desai
